Best Schools in Redlands, CO
Redlands, CO has a total of 18 schools including 5 high schools, 5 middle schools and 8 elementary schools. A total of 11,032 students attend Redlands, CO schools. On average, schools in Redlands score 35%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 34%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Redlands meet expectations.

Community Factors
Redlands, CO has a total population of 12,207 with 23%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 98%, and 53%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
